Vanimel panchayat seeks review of ban on construction activities


The Vanimel grama panchayat authorities have urged the district administration to review the recent ban imposed on various construction activities in three wards under the panchayat limits. The restrictions followed an official meeting chaired by District Collector Snehil Kumar Singh to assess the impact of the Vilangad landslides, based on a recent field study.

Grama panchayat president P. Surayya said the ban would hinder the completion of several housing schemes and road development works in areas that were minimally affected by the 2024 landslides. “Of the three wards identified for construction restrictions, Ward number 11 was the least impacted by the calamity. If the order is not withdrawn, it will adversely affect the owners of many partially completed residential and commercial buildings,” she said.

Ms. Surayya also pointed out that the ban was imposed by the district administration without waiting for the completion of the ongoing field study by an expert panel. “Our request is to defer such hasty regulations until the final report is submitted. Moreover, the latest order was passed without seeking the opinion of the elected representatives,” she added.

A local body member from Vanimel claimed that the unexpected move could disrupt several works previously listed under the Mahatma Gandhi National Rural Employment Guarantee Scheme. “We are equally concerned about the timely completion of various rural road projects,” he said.

Meanwhile, sources in the Revenue department said that the ban was based on scientific findings and cannot be revoked merely on the basis of local concerns. They added that the complaint submitted by the panchayat authorities to the Disaster Management wing would be brought to the attention of the higher officials for appropriate action.
